A instrument designed for HVAC (Heating, Air flow, and Air Conditioning) professionals facilitates correct refrigerant cost calculations for air-con methods. This calculation considers the size and diameter of the refrigerant strains connecting the indoor and out of doors items, guaranteeing optimum system efficiency and effectivity. As an example, a system with longer strains requires extra refrigerant to compensate for the elevated quantity. Incorrect refrigerant ranges can result in decreased cooling capability, elevated power consumption, and potential harm to the compressor.
Correct refrigerant charging is essential for the longevity and environment friendly operation of HVAC methods. Traditionally, figuring out the proper cost concerned complicated handbook calculations and infrequently relied on experience-based estimations. This digital calculation methodology minimizes the chance of overcharging or undercharging, which might result in expensive repairs and lowered system lifespan. Correctly charged methods function at peak efficiency, consuming much less power and contributing to decrease utility payments.
